Free choice profiling

Free choice profiling is a method for determining the quality of a thing by having a large number of subjects experience (view, taste, read, etc.) it and then allowing them to describe the thing in their own words, as opposed to posing them a set of "yes-no-maybe" questions. All of the descriptions are then analyzed to determine a "consensus configuration" of qualities.

Dr Françoise Wemelsfelder is a well known scientist who has done extensive research in this field.
